Already developers like Boyer Corp. and Woodbury have told city officials that a developer would have to spend between $25 million and $30 million just to turn the mall around. "You have to spend a lot to really turn it around," Garlick said. So far no developer has offered to take on the mall.

The project also faces a budget shortfall. According to the city's redevelopment budget, it will cost $22.7 million to purchase land, rebuild infrastructure and put in landscaping. However, estimates show that the tax-increment financing from the area would only bring in $15.6 million in usable funds.

Brooks said the City Council may have to consider throwing in the $7 million in additional tax dollars to make the plan float.

Those on the RDA committee acknowledged that a lot of money is involved in trying to kick-start a downtown for West Valley City, but, they said, the alternative is to lose the mall completely and have the city's center continue to decline in value.

Although Costco has yet to make a definite deal, officials said they expect the store could be open by 2007.
